Original scientific paper
RESOLVING DATABASE CONSTRAINT COLLISIONS USING IIS*CASE TOOL
Sonja Ristić
; Faculty of Technical Sciences University of Novi Sad, Novi Sad, Serbia
Ivan Luković
; Faculty of Technical Sciences University of Novi Sad, Novi Sad, Serbia
Jelena Pavičević
; Faculty of Science University of Montenegro, Montenegro
Pavle Mogin
; School of Mathematical and Computing Sciences Victoria University of Wellington, New Zealand
Abstract
Integrated Information Systems*Case (IIS*Case) R.6.21 is a CASE tool that we developed to support automated database (db) schema design, based on a methodology of gradual integration of independently designed subschemas into a database schema. It provides complete intelligent support for developing db schemas and enables designers to work together and cooperate reaching the most appropriate solutions. The process of independent design of subschemas may lead to collisions in expressing the real world constraints and business rules. IIS*Case uses specialized algorithms for checking the consistency of constraints embedded in the database schema and the subschemas. IIS*Case supports designers in reviewing and validating results obtained after each step of the design process. The paper outlines the process of resolving collisions. A case study based on an imaginary production system is used to illustrate the application of IIS*Case. Different outcomes and their consequences are presented.
Keywords
database schema design and integration; CASE tool; constraint collisions; IIS*Case
Hrčak ID:
21485
URI
Publication date:
12.6.2007.
Visits: 1.333 *